Q: Is 670,404 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 670,404 is a composite number.

Why is 670,404 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 670,404 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 7 12 14 21 23 28 42 46 69 84 92 138 161 276 322 347 483 644 694 966 1,041 1,388 1,932 2,082 2,429 4,164 4,858 7,287 7,981 9,716 14,574 15,962 23,943 29,148 31,924 47,886 55,867 95,772 111,734 167,601 223,468 335,202 and 670,404, with no remainder.

Since 670,404 cannot be divided by just 1 and 670,404, it is a composite number.
